I found myself asking, &#8216;Who cares?&#8221; as I read through the first few chapter outlines. In fact, I&#8217;d already read chapters of her book and I did care very much&#8211;this book has a large potential audience who is desperate for the powerful tools this author has to offer. It just didn&#8217;t come across in the chapter outlines at all.<\/p>\n<p>If you write your chapter outlines with the following perspective in mind, you&#8217;ll avoid that problem and come up with a compelling and motivating outline for your book proposal.<\/p>\n<p>As your write about what&#8217;s in each chapter, keep in mind your readers&#8217; biggest problems, challenges and goals. What benefits or results are they looking for? You might start your outline with, &#8220;The chapter begins with a story about x that illustrates y.&#8221; In this single sentence, you can capture some sense of either the problem, the benefits of your solution or both.<\/p>\n<h3>Chapter Outlines Should Highlight Readers&#8217; Takeaways<\/h3>\n<p>Make sure to highlight the takeaways of each chapter:<\/p>\n<p>*\u00a0 Will your readers reach a new understanding or perspective? Clarify.<\/p>\n<p>*\u00a0 What new tools will readers have and what results may these tools help them produce in their lives or work?<\/p>\n<p><figure id=\"attachment_6969\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-6969\" style=\"width: 300px\" class=\"wp-caption alignleft\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-medium wp-image-6969 \" title=\"persononcell\" src=\"https:\/\/jodieburdette.net\/lisatener\/wp-content\/uploads\/2012\/09\/persononcell-300x240.jpg\" alt=\"know your book reader\" width=\"300\" height=\"240\" srcset=\"https:\/\/jodieburdette.net\/lisatener\/wp-content\/uploads\/2012\/09\/persononcell-300x240.jpg 300w, https:\/\/jodieburdette.net\/lisatener\/wp-content\/uploads\/2012\/09\/persononcell-1024x819.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/jodieburdette.net\/lisatener\/wp-content\/uploads\/2012\/09\/persononcell-150x120.jpg 150w, https:\/\/jodieburdette.net\/lisatener\/wp-content\/uploads\/2012\/09\/persononcell-768x614.jpg 768w, https:\/\/jodieburdette.net\/lisatener\/wp-content\/uploads\/2012\/09\/persononcell-100x80.jpg 100w, https:\/\/jodieburdette.net\/lisatener\/wp-content\/uploads\/2012\/09\/persononcell-640x512.jpg 640w, https:\/\/jodieburdette.net\/lisatener\/wp-content\/uploads\/2012\/09\/persononcell.jpg 1500w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 300px) 100vw, 300px\" \/><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-6969\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">The more your understand your readers&#8217; needs and who your readers are, the easier it will be to write your chapter outlines. [photo by David Donohue]<\/figcaption><\/figure>*\u00a0 What stories do you have to illustrate your points and make the material come alive? You can use the above format to simplify rather than trying to summarize the story, unless your book is more narrative in nature (this post assumes a more prescriptive self-help \/ how-to book rather than something narrative).<\/p>\n<p>* What features are included in the chapter (a sidebar that describes the latest research? a quotation, several exercises?)?<\/p>\n<p>For a prescriptive book, it&#8217;s fine to bullet point. You don&#8217;t have to capture absolutely everything in the chapter&#8211;focus on what&#8217;s going to empower your readers and be most important to them. Your chapter also doesn&#8217;t need to teach agents and publishers the material. They just want to know that you have enough material, fresh material, that you address the needs of your readers, that it&#8217;s well organized, etc.<\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/jodieburdette.net\/lisatener\/how-to-write-a-book-proposal\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\">Writing a book proposal<\/a>?
